Ada
Pros
- Unified AI agent works consistently across voice, email, chat, SMS, and social channels from one reasoning layer
- Deep integration ecosystem with 20+ CRM, helpdesk, and telephony platforms including Zendesk, Salesforce, and Genesys
- Enterprise-grade compliance (HIPAA, SOC2, GDPR) with multi-layer safety controls and zero data retention with LLM providers
- Proven results with named enterprise clients showing 80%+ automated resolution rates and measurable CSAT improvements
Cons
- No self-serve pricing or free tier—requires sales engagement, making it inaccessible for small businesses or startups
- Heavily enterprise-focused platform likely requires significant setup, integration work, and ongoing optimization with Ada's team
- Limited transparency on costs means it's difficult to budget without going through the sales process
Levity
Pros
- Purpose-built for freight/logistics with domain-specific workflows like load building and appointment scheduling
- Combines email automation, phone AI, and operations analytics in a single platform
- Enterprise-grade security with ISO 27001, SOC 2, and GDPR compliance hosted in Europe
- No learning curve for end users — automation runs in the background without changing existing workflows
Cons
- Narrowly focused on freight and logistics; not suitable as a general-purpose automation tool
- No self-serve pricing or free trial — requires demo and sales engagement
- Limited public information on specific TMS and tool integrations supported
